Japan PSE Certification
PSE certification is a compulsory safety certification in Japan. It is used to prove that electrical and electronic products have passed the safety standards test of the Japanese Electrical and Material Safety Law (DENAN Law) or international IEC standards. Japan's DENTORL Act (Electrical Device and Material Control Act) stipulates that 506 products must pass safety certification to enter the Japanese market. Among them, 165 types of A products should obtain the diamond-shaped PSE mark, and 341 types of B products should obtain the circular PSE mark.
Since April 1, 2001, the Electrical Product Control Act (DENTORL) has been officially renamed the Electrical Product Safety Act (DENAN). Unlike the control of the agreement provisions of the previous regulatory system, the new system will ensure product safety by unofficial agencies.
